About the role
Responsibilities
- Develop and implement board-level functional test modules for PCIe accelerator cards, covering power-on sequencing, firmware load, and PCIe link training
- Architect manufacturing test strategies for upcoming server platforms, including system-level integration and BMC/IPMC firmware validation
- Design scalable, maintainable test implementation strategies focused on automation and standardization
- Analyze test data to optimize manufacturing efficiency and identify yield-limiting patterns
- Partner with Manufacturing Quality Engineering to drive root cause analysis and corrective actions
- Deploy test capabilities at manufacturing sites and provide hands-on training to partner teams
- Provide on-call support and triage floor failures
Requirements
- BS in Electrical Engineering, Computer Science, Computer Engineering, or a related technical discipline
- 10+ years of experience in manufacturing test software development for high-volume hardware
- Direct experience with PCIe card, NIC, GPU, or server/storage hardware manufacturing test
- Strong knowledge of PCIe protocol, board-level power sequencing, and functional test methodologies
- Proficiency in Python for test automation and data analysis
- Experience with Linux/Unix environments, shell scripting, and command-line debug tools
- Familiarity with JTAG/boundary scan and in-system test methodologies
- Proven ability to lead technical initiatives and influence cross-functional teams
Preferred Qualifications
- Experience with high-volume manufacturing floor operations (100K+ units/year)
- Familiarity with OCP hardware specifications or hyperscaler standards
- Experience with BMC/IPMC firmware validation and Redfish management interfaces
- Proficiency with statistical analysis tools like JMP, Minitab, or Python-based equivalents
- Knowledge of quality methodologies such as 8D, FMEA, DOE, and fishbone analysis
